Medical applications
Lupiflex 8 Tablet is a combination medication containing Ketoprofen 100 mg and Thiocolchicoside 8 mg, formulated for the management of musculoskeletal pain and associated inflammatory conditions. Ketoprofen, a n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ID), exerts its therapeutic effect by inhibiting cyclooxygenase enzymes (COX-1 and COX-2), thereby reducing the synthesis of prostaglandins responsible for pain, inflammation, and fever. Thiocolchicoside, a muscle relaxant with anti-inflammatory properties, acts as a selective antagonist of GABA and glycine receptors in the spinal cord, leading to muscle relaxation and relief from muscle spasms. The combination of these two active ingredients provides effective symptomatic relief in conditions such as acute musculoskeletal disorders, low back pain, muscle spasms, and painful inflammatory states. Lupiflex 8 is indicated for short-term use under medical supervision due to potential side effects associated with NSAIDs, including gastrointestinal irritation, cardiovascular risks, and renal impairment. Thiocolchicoside may cause drowsiness or dizziness; therefore, caution is advised when performing tasks requiring alertness. Contraindications include hypersensitivity to either component, peptic ulcer disease, severe hepatic or renal impairment, and pregnancy. Dosage and duration should be individualized based on clinical response and tolerability. Regular monitoring is recommended during prolonged therapy to minimize adverse effects.
How to use Lupiflex Tablet Take this medicine in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Swallow it as a whole. Do not chew, crush or break it. Lupiflex 8 Tablet is to be taken with food.
